B. Carrière is a scholar working on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Surfaces, Coatings and Films and Electrical and Electronic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, B. Carrière has authored 61 papers receiving a total of 939 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 40 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, 26 papers in Surfaces, Coatings and Films and 20 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ering. Recurrent topics in B. Carrière's work include Electron and X-Ray Spectroscopy Techniques (26 papers), Surface and Thin Film Phenomena (26 papers) and Magnetic properties of thin films (22 papers). B. Carrière is often cited by papers focused on Electron and X-Ray Spectroscopy Techniques (26 papers), Surface and Thin Film Phenomena (26 papers) and Magnetic properties of thin films (22 papers). B. Carrière collaborates with scholars based in France, Switzerland and Romania. B. Carrière's co-authors include J.P. Deville, Bernard Lang, Fabrice Scheurer, C. Boeglin, Antoine Barbier, P. Légaré, G. Maire, J. Escard, D. Brion and K. Hricovíni and has published in prestigious journals such as Physical Review Letters, Physical review. B, Condensed matter and Physical Review B.
